Household Income in Heath ONS 2023
The average total household income in Heath is approximately £43,981 a year before tax, 20% below the national average of £55,302. After tax and benefits, the average disposable (net) household income is around £33,777. These are modelled estimates from the Office for National Statistics for the financial year ending 2023.

Businesses in Heath ONS 2025
There are approximately 1,554 active businesses based in Heath, around 25 for every 1,000 residents. The local economy is dominated by small firms: about 83% are micro-businesses employing fewer than 10 people, while 56 are larger employers with 50 or more staff. Figures are from the Office for National Statistics UK Business Counts.

Home Ownership in Heath
Of the 27,006 households in and around Heath, 56% are owned, 29% are socially rented and 15% are privately rented. Home ownership here is lower than the England and Wales average of 63%.
Tenure from the 2021 Census (ONS), for the postcode districts covering Heath.
